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 26.11.2017, 13:31   #1
Виктория67850
Новичок
Джуниор
 
Регистрация: 26.11.2017
Сообщений: 1
По умолчанию Найдите пожалуйста, ошибку в коде калькулятора

Dim a As Double
Dim b As String
Dim mem As Double
Private Sub CommandButton1_Click()
TextBox1.Text = TextBox1.Text & "7"

End Sub


Private Sub CommandButton10_Click()
TextBox1.Text = TextBox1.Text & "0"

End Sub


Private Sub CommandButton12_Click()
a = Val(TextBox1.Text)
TextBox1.Text = " "
b = "+"
End Sub

Private Sub CommandButton13_Click()
If b = "" Then
a = Val(TextBox1.Text)
ElseIf b = " + " Then
a = a + Val(TextBox1.Text)
ElseIf b = " - " Then
a = a - Val(TextBox1.Text)
ElseIf b = " * " Then
a = a * Val(TextBox1.Text)
ElseIf b = " / " Then
a = a / Val(TextBox1.Text)
End If
TextBox1.Text = " "
b = " - "


End Sub

Private Sub CommandButton14_Click()
If b = " + " Then
TextBox1.Text = TextBox1.Text + Val(a)
ElseIf b = " - " Then
TextBox1.Text = Val(a) - TextBox1.Text
ElseIf b = " * " Then
TextBox1.Text = Val(a) * TextBox1.Text
ElseIf b = " / " Then
TextBox1.Text = Val(a) / TextBox1.Text
End If
a = " "
b = " "


End Sub

Private Sub CommandButton15_Click()
TextBox1.Text = " "
End Sub

Private Sub CommandButton16_Click()
mem = mem + Val(TextBox1.Text)
End Sub

Private Sub CommandButton17_Click()
mem = mem - Val(TextBox1.Text)
End Sub

Private Sub CommandButton2_Click()
TextBox1.Text = TextBox1.Text & "8"

End Sub

Private Sub CommandButton3_Click()
TextBox1.Text = TextBox1.Text & "9"

End Sub

Private Sub CommandButton4_Click()
TextBox1.Text = TextBox1.Text & "4"
End Sub

Private Sub CommandButton5_Click()
TextBox1.Text = TextBox1.Text & "5"
End Sub

Private Sub CommandButton6_Click()
TextBox1.Text = TextBox1.Text & "6"

End Sub

Private Sub CommandButton7_Click()
TextBox1.Text = TextBox1.Text & "1"

End Sub

Private Sub CommandButton8_Click()
TextBox1.Text = TextBox1.Text & "2"

End Sub

Private Sub CommandButton9_Click()
TextBox1.Text = TextBox1.Text & "3"

End Sub
Виктория67850 в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
С++: найдите ошибку в коде inka19 Помощь студентам 5 19.03.2017 18:52
Помогите найти ошибку в коде калькулятора Кари C# (си шарп) 6 15.05.2016 09:27
Найдите ошибку в коде saturn377 JavaScript, Ajax 13 09.03.2016 10:10
найдите ошибку в коде TopoRRR Помощь студентам 6 15.12.2009 10:30
найдите ошибку в коде pony Помощь студентам 1 14.09.2009 10:03